Установка CoolRunner на Jasper

Тема в разделе "Всё о Freeboot", создана пользователем SAMuel, 13.05.2013.

  1.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Купил чип CoolRunner ver.C
    Имею х360 jasper ver2 с 512мб на борту.
    Привод лайтон, модель непомню какая, но вроде родной, прошит тоже непомню чем, может LT какой.
    Дашбоард 2.0.12625.0 (2.0.1888.0)

    Изготовил USB флешер, скачал J-Runner v02 Beta (288-) Core Pack
    Посмотрел там инструкции как прошивать и как паять.
    Вроде все понятно но есть пара вопросов:
    1- какая разница между RGH1 и RGH2
    2- как насчет надежности глитча? (вроде как jasper-ы подвержены иногда умирать от него)
    3- cудя по моему дашу мне можно ставить как RGH1 так и RGH2 ?
     
  2. voldemaro

    voldemaro Пользователь

    Регистрация:
    28.05.2011
    Сообщения:
    2.543
    Симпатии:
    369
    здесь даже думать не нужно, конечно ставь ргх1
     
  3. msat

    msat Пользователь

    Регистрация:
    31.03.2012
    Сообщения:
    534
    Симпатии:
    28
    SAMuel, не делай RGH
    делай JTAG
    таких дашей 1 на 10000
    и глич не нужен - 2 диода или транзистора
     
  4.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Если я правильно понял, то ставить мне вариант RGH1.
    По содержащимся картинкам-мануалам(которые внутри проги J-Runner) мне подходит инструкция tx_revc_phat_rgh1.jpg ,
    ну а прошивка Jasper.xsvf , верно ?
    А обьясни разницу между ними, ну всмысле чем различаются RGH1 и RGH2 ?
    И что за резистор и конденсатор порой паяют ?
    --- добавлено: May 13, 2013 6:36 AM ---
    msat, пардон, писал ночью и пропустил цифорку, у меня даш 2.0.12625.0, пара диодов уже не выйдет :(
     
  5. koxakos

    koxakos Пользователь

    Регистрация:
    04.03.2013
    Сообщения:
    104
    Симпатии:
    6
    Все очевидно же, RGH1 - если даш не выше 14719 (как в твоем случае), RGH2 - если даш 15574 и выше, более не стабильней чем RGH1 ( RGH1 - уже не установить).
    Оптимизация запуска, после установки еще гемор с запуском, может и 5 секунд пройти пока загрузиться, а может и 5 минут, вообще читай вот http:-//www.hackfaq.net/community/index.php?threads/6786/ ИМХО!
     
  6.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    koxakos, спасибо, это я читал, что в зависимости от текущей версии даша ставится тот или иной глич.
    Вот почему так?
    Мысля что что-то изменили в ПО приставке, и получается что распайка глитчев разная требуется.
    Вот и интересно именно этот момент.
    Ещё читал что есть какието CB (совсем непонял что это)

    А бокс начну вечером разбирать и запаивать панельки штырьков или голые штырьки чтоб считать прошу, а пока потулил на работу.
     
  7. koxakos

    koxakos Пользователь

    Регистрация:
    04.03.2013
    Сообщения:
    104
    Симпатии:
    6
    Новый даш закрывает старые дыры для влома, новый взлом требует и другую распайку!
    Связано с напряжениями питания памяти и т.д - не торопи повозку, для начала хотябы считай без ошибок Nand.
    Мой совет, как дойдешь до пайки Glich - старайся паять все с первого раза, не перегревай по пол часа пытаясь уложить провод по 10 раз, а то пятак на раз оторвать!
     
  8.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Итак, вот толко запаял штырьки в плату, подсоеденил USB флешер, и снимаю дампы нанда(несколько для верности)
    Дамп сделало не 512мб а только то что оно по умолчанию само сдампило, 69.206.016 байт
    Сдампил 4 раза подряд, есть ошибки, 10шт, во всех 4х дампах все они одни и теже.
    Error: 250 reading block A80
    Error: 250 reading block A88
    Error: 210 reading block A89
    Error: 210 reading block A8A
    Error: 210 reading block A8B
    Error: 210 reading block A8C
    Error: 210 reading block A8D
    Error: 210 reading block A8E
    Error: 210 reading block A8F
    Error: 250 reading block B90


    Flash Config: 0x00AA3020
    CB Version: 6750
     
  9. Hedzhi

    Hedzhi "20 000"

    Регистрация:
    25.09.2011
    Сообщения:
    6.683
    Симпатии:
    938
    Ну эт видимо столько бедов набралось. Если все ошибки одинаковы и дампы все сходятся по хешу, то не обращай на них внимания, они автоматом заремапятся.
     
  10.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Походу так и есть, заремапились - Bad Blocks Remapped
    у всех файлов один и тотже MD5 хеш
    Снимал дампы J-Runner v02

    Чип CoolRunner я отдельно завтра прошью на другом пк, так как нет у меня LPT на материнке физически, а пока мне получается нада в J-Runner пропустить кнопку "Flash CoolRunner" и выполнять следующюю кнопку "Create ECC" потом "Write ECC" далее "Create Image'' и собственно "Write Nand" ну а после этого припаять чип, верно мыслю?
     
  11. Yegorky

    Yegorky Пользователь

    Регистрация:
    25.11.2011
    Сообщения:
    701
    Симпатии:
    58
    Create Image будет недоступна пока не запустишь Хелл и не считаешь ключ проца, его нужно будет вписать в строчку КПУ кей (если по лану ключ получать, то он автоматом туда встанет). Т.е. Create ECC" потом "Write ECC", паяешь прошитый глич, ждешь запуска Хелл, получаешь ключ, далее "Create Image'' и собственно "Write Nand"
     
    SAMuel нравится это.
  12.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Тоесть немного не так как я думал, походу нада выполнить "Create ECC" потом "Write ECC" далее подпаять чип зашитый и получить ключи, далее "Create Image'' отпаять чип и подключить usb флешер и собственно "Write Nand" далее запаять обратно чип и радоваться (не щитая возможного гемора со стабильным запуском), верно?
     
  13. Yegorky

    Yegorky Пользователь

    Регистрация:
    25.11.2011
    Сообщения:
    701
    Симпатии:
    58
    не нужно отпаивать чип!
     
  14.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    хм, а не будет ли он влиять на работу с нандом?
    смотрел вот инструкцию она под слим но особо то разницы нет в работе с софтом на пк.
    правда смотрю два варианта заливки готового Image есть, как при помощи флешера так и просто через usb флешку.

    кстати в каком положении должен быть переключатель NOR - PRG при записи-чтении нанда и когда все готово для игры?
     
  15. koxakos

    koxakos Пользователь

    Регистрация:
    04.03.2013
    Сообщения:
    104
    Симпатии:
    6
    Отпаивать нужно программатор, а Glich - как бы и служит для запуска ломаного Даша, он остается.
    Быстрее и проще с флешки! Если не выйдет как описано в FAQ "Собираем образ для записи через XeLL", то необходимо будет:
    - Скачать rawflash_v4.zip и распаковываем в корень флешки
    - Положить в корень флешки файл nandflash.bin уже модифицированный и все будет ОК
     
    SAMuel нравится это.
  16.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    koxakos ага, понятненько, какраз вот только нашел инфу про переключатель NOR и PRG, когда нанд шьем то переключатель в положении PRG, а когда все готово для игр то положение NOR, он питание отключает чтобы не повредился NAND при прошивке. тогда никакого влияния не должно быть. я флешер не припаивал, я в мать бокса впаял штырьки и программатор просто шлейф на штыри одеваю, люблю акуратность и функциональность, так что достаточно просто выдернуть шлейф с платы и все :)
     
    qwertyv35 нравится это.
  17. koxakos

    koxakos Пользователь

    Регистрация:
    04.03.2013
    Сообщения:
    104
    Симпатии:
    6
    посмотришь на свою акуратность и функциональность когда Glich паять будешь:smug:
     
  18.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    koxakos, конечно стараюсь, вечером буду шить и паять чипик :)
     
  19. Hedzhi

    Hedzhi "20 000"

    Регистрация:
    25.09.2011
    Сообщения:
    6.683
    Симпатии:
    938
    Нор и прг не влияют на нанд вообще, этот переключатель нужен если прошиваешь глич припаянный к подключенной к питанию консоли, что бы питание с консоли и с прогера не встретились.

    И смотри слишком не пересторайся, еще пятаки перегреешь, они да поотваливаются.
     
  20. SAMuel

    SAMuel Пользователь

    Регистрация:
    13.05.2013
    Сообщения:
    162
    Симпатии:
    10
    Вобщем прошил я чипик по вот этой инструкции http:-//hackfaq.net/xbox/fa/step3.shtml
    Пока чип не припаивал, пока пытаюсь выполнить "Create ECC" потом "Write ECC" и оно не хочет писать в бокс ничего.
    В чем проблема может крыться?
    вот лог:
    Version: 01
    Wrong Arm Version.
    * unpacking flash image, ....
    Spare Data found, will remove.
    Removed
    * found decrypted CD
    * found XeLL binary, must be linked to 0x1c000000
    * we found the following parts:
    SMC: 2.3
    CB_A: 6750
    CB_B: missing
    CD (image): 8453
    CD (decrypted): 8453
    * this image will be valid *only* for: jasper (CB_6750)
    * patching SMC...
    Patching Jasper version 2.3 SMC at offset 0x12BA
    * zero-pairing...
    * constructing new image...
    * encrypting CB...
    * encrypting CD...
    * base size: 70000
    * No separate recovery Xell available!
    * Flash Layout:
    0x0..0x1FF (0x200 bytes) Header
    0x200..0xFFF (0xE00 bytes) Padding
    0x1000..0x3FFF (0x3000 bytes) SMC
    0x4000..0x7FFF (0x4000 bytes) Keyvault
    0x8000..0x11A3F (0x9A40 bytes) CB_A 6750
    0x11A40..0x17A3F (0x6000 bytes) CD 8453
    0x17A40..0xBFFFF (0xA85C0 bytes) Padding
    0xC0000..0xFFFFF (0x40000 bytes) Xell (backup)
    0x100000..0x13FFFF (0x40000 bytes) Xell (main)
    * Encoding ECC...Done!
    ------------- Written into output\image_00000000.ecc

    Version: 01
    Flash Config: 0x00AA3020
    Writing Nand
    image_00000000.ecc
    Failed to write 0x0 block
    Failed to write 0x1 block
    Failed to write 0x2 block
    Failed to write 0x3 block
    Failed to write 0x4 block
    Failed to write 0x5 block
    Failed to write 0x6 block
    Failed to write 0x7 block
    Failed to write 0x8 block
    Failed to write 0x9 block
    Failed to write 0xA block
    Failed to write 0xB block
    Failed to write 0xC block
    Failed to write 0xD block
    Failed to write 0xE block
    Failed to write 0xF block
    Failed to write 0x10 block
    Failed to write 0x11 block
    Failed to write 0x12 block
    Failed to write 0x13 block
    Failed to write 0x14 block
    Failed to write 0x15 block
    Failed to write 0x16 block
    Failed to write 0x17 block
    Failed to write 0x18 block
    Failed to write 0x19 block
    Failed to write 0x1A block
    Failed to write 0x1B block
    Failed to write 0x1C block
    Failed to write 0x1D block
    Failed to write 0x1E block
    Failed to write 0x1F block
    Failed to write 0x20 block
    Failed to write 0x21 block
    Failed to write 0x22 block
    Failed to write 0x23 block
    Failed to write 0x24 block
    Failed to write 0x25 block
    Failed to write 0x26 block
    Failed to write 0x27 block
    Failed to write 0x28 block
    Failed to write 0x29 block
    Failed to write 0x2A block
    Failed to write 0x2B block
    Failed to write 0x2C block
    Failed to write 0x2D block
    Failed to write 0x2E block
    Failed to write 0x2F block
    Failed to write 0x30 block
    Failed to write 0x31 block
    Failed to write 0x32 block
    Failed to write 0x33 block
    Failed to write 0x34 block
    Failed to write 0x35 block
    Failed to write 0x36 block
    Failed to write 0x37 block
    Failed to write 0x38 block
    Failed to write 0x39 block
    Failed to write 0x3A block
    Failed to write 0x3B block
    Failed to write 0x3C block
    Failed to write 0x3D block
    Failed to write 0x3E block
    Failed to write 0x3F block
    Failed to write 0x40 block
    Failed to write 0x41 block
    Failed to write 0x42 block
    Failed to write 0x43 block
    Failed to write 0x44 block
    Failed to write 0x45 block
    Failed to write 0x46 block
    Failed to write 0x47 block
    Failed to write 0x48 block
    Failed to write 0x49 block
    Failed to write 0x4A block
    Failed to write 0x4B block
    Failed to write 0x4C block
    Failed to write 0x4D block
    Failed to write 0x4E block
    Failed to write 0x4F block
    Done!
    in 0:30 min:sec

    Таксь, давайте попорядку, бокс у меня jasper 512мб, сколько в J-Runner нада дампить метров прошивки ? может я не тот обьем дамплю?
    Флешер USB собрал такой как тут в FAQ описан.
    Чипик прошил тоже как FAQ описано.
     

Поделиться этой страницей